Phase holographic optical elements and geometrical optics

Journal of the Optical Society of America A, 1997
In the framework of geometrical optics, we show that the general ray-tracing formula for finding the direction of the diffracted rays for thin phase holographic optical elements located on any arbitrary continuous surface can be derived in a form similar to Fermat's principle.

Achromatic triplet using holographic optical elements

Applied Optics, 1977
An achromatic optical system can be made using three holographic optical elements. A very simple design scheme is presented, and the properties of the system are discussed.

A Holographic Optical Element for an Integrated Optical Head

Optical Review, 1996
Diffraction efficiencies of a reflection-type blazed holographic optical element (HOE) are analyzed and optimized for use in a totally integrated optical head. The HOE, consisting of four-step phase levels, was fabricated by a double-etching process.
